﻿id	summary	reporter	owner	description	type	status	priority	milestone	component	version	severity	resolution	keywords	cc
165	Binutils too old to support AVX2	Dave Yeo		"While GCC reports AVX2 is available,
{{{
# gcc -mavx2 -dM -E - < /dev/null | egrep ""AVX"" | sort
#define __AVX__ 1
#define __AVX2__ 1
}}}
AS errors out when compiling AVX2 code, eg from flac git head,
{{{
R:/tmp/ccwvrScM.s:8773: Error: operand type mismatch for `vpsrlq'
R:/tmp/ccwvrScM.s:8778: Error: no such instruction: `vpermd %ymm1,%ymm5,%ymm0'
R:/tmp/ccwvrScM.s:8859: Error: operand type mismatch for `vpmovzxdq'
}}}

Our binutils version 2.21 is close to 5 years old and Paul's newest release is binutils v2.25 2015-01-08.
"	defect	closed	Feedback Pending		rpm		low	fixed		
